BS EN 61237-2:1995 Broadcast video tape recorders. Methods of measurement - Pary 2. Electrical measurements of analogue composite video signals

This part of IEC 1237 describes the test signals and measuring methods for equipments mainly dedicated to record/playback analogue composite TV-signals on magnetic tape on reels or in cassettes.
The allowable tolerances for the rated values for acceptable performance are not given in this standard, but may be derived from the specifications for the related system, i.e. appropriate publications, manufacturers' specifications, etc.
The necessary reference and calibration tapes are either mentioned in the specific IEC publication of equipment under test or included in IEC 1105 (reference tapes) and IEC 1295 (calibration tapes).
The principal object of this standard is to describe the methods of measurement, test signals and procedures which may apply to characteristics of video recording/playback machines mainly intended for professional use. The measuring methods described here- after do not directly concern home equipment and it would appear that some will be difficult to apply to them.
